The phrase "almost commonly" is not standard in written English and may cause confusion.
It could be used in contexts where you want to indicate that something is nearly common but not quite.
Example: "The practice of remote work is almost commonly accepted in many industries today."
Alternatives: "nearly common" or "frequently seen".
